Temel Veri Tipleri

Değişkenler, içerinse farklı türlerde veri saklayabilen bellek gözeneklerinin programlamadaki karşılığıdır. Derleyici tanımlama satırını görünce bellekte nesnenin özelliğine göre yer ayırır.

Veri tipleri 2'ye ayrılır.

1.Önceden tanımlanmış veri türleri

Referans ve Value olarak 2'ye ayrılır.

Bellekte tutuldukları yerler farklıdır.

2.Kullanıcı tarafından tanımlanmış(sonradan)

 

Veri bellekte 6 bölgeden birinde tutulur

 

1.Stack Bölgesi =RAM in stack bölgesinde tutulur. Veri boyutu bilirnir bellete ona göre yer ayrılır.

2.Heap Bölgesi= Derleyici tarafından veri boyutu bilinmesi zorunlu değildir. Stack e göre yavaştır.

3.Register Bölgesi=Stack ve heap göre çok hızlıdır.

 

4.Static Bölge= Programın bütün çalışma süresince saklanır.

5.Sabit Bölge= Sadece okuma amaçlıdır.ROM da tutulur.

6.RAM olmayan Bölge= Program çalımadığı durumda tutulur. Hardisk ve floppy.